Prepaid Local Tax on motor fuel is calculated by multiplying the prepaid local tax rate by the applicable average retail price (in the chart below) by the number of gallons sold. WebNet worth is based on capital stock, paid in surplus, and retained earnings. The tax is graduated, and ranges from a minimum nothing for $100,000 or less of net worth up to a maximum of $5,000 for net worth over $22 million. You can find complete net worth tax tables for recent years in Georgia booklet IT 611.
